Grant Allows Latino Services to Expand

By

For the past several years, a church in Sparta has been offering English classes and other programs for Latino immigrants. Now, with the help of a three-year, $190,000 grant from the Jessie Ball DuPont Fund, St. John’s Episcopal Church as opened a Hispanic resource center that will eventually operate as a separate, non-profit entity.
